Oct. 30, 1999
Clemson, S.C.- - Jason Cropley (La Canada, Calif.) scored for the ninth-ranked Maryland (13-4) men's soccer team at 81:14 to lift the Terps 2-1 over Clemson (8-6-2) for the first time in two years.
Clemson started off the scoring at 17:30 when Mike Potempa fired a shot that rebounded off the crossbar. Bob Cavanagh settled the ball and found Ian Fuller in front of the goal who slipped one past Terrapin keeper Christian Lewis (Ellicott City, Md.). The game was Lewis' first in over two weeks since he was sidelined by a bulging disc in his back. The goal was the only he would conceed all day. He also ended the game with one save.
Maryland brought the score even before halftime when Cropley found the net off a shot from dead center, 15 yards out. Taylor Twellman (St. Louis, Mo.) served the ball to Cropley, while Mike Shebuski (Bloomington, Minn.) generated the start of the play.
Both teams contested the last fifty minutes of the game very intensely, resulting in six cards (two for the Maryland and four for Clemson) before time expired. The game went scoreless until Cropley hit again on a play that started with Siba Mohammed (Tamale, Ghana). Siba managed the pass to Cropley while falling to the ground. Cropley then hit the net from 15 yards out past Tiger goalkeeper Marc Paisant. With Cropley's second goal of the night, the score became 2-1 and brought the Terps their first victory at Riggs Field since 1988.
Maryland has a week off before it concludes its regular season schedule against Wisconsin at Ludwig Field next Saturday, Nov. 6, at 1 p.m. Saturday will also be senior day for the Terps. The ACC Tournament begins th Nov. 11 at Wake Forest.
